Graph Visualization
I am looking for some library or example which will allow me to display a graph of some different 2D (and eventually 3D) regions. There should be some way (color or otherwise) to differentiate between different regions. See the following example: http: // img190.imageshack.us/i/ 2dgraph.png/
I have investigated some graph libraries such as JFreeChart and JUNG but they only allow the graphing of 2D regions versus the X-axis and have no support for 3D graphing. Can anyone suggest a library or know of an example which allows a display like this?
